VCF MESTALLA TO PLAY THE Premier League International Cup 24-25
Valencia CF's 'B' team (VCF Mestalla) will face different English teams in the U21 competition
VCF Mestalla retuns to competition one more year at international level. The team will participate in Premier League International Cup, a U21 competition that organizes the Premier League where 16 english teams will face off against other teams from countries like Germany, France, Netherlands, Portugal, Croatia, Denmark or Belgium.
The team led by Miguel Ángel Angulo will play this tournament for the third year in a row. The VCF Mestalla made it to the semifinals in the 2022/23 season. This year there will be 32 teams competing.

This year VCF Mestalla is part of Group A and will face 4 english teams: Nottingham Forest, Reading, Wolverhampton and Tottenham Hotspurs.

The 36 participating teams are divided into four groups of 8, in which each team plays 4 games before the English teams and in which the first two in each group qualify for the quarterfinals.
